The brief
A new AI model has shown that humans allocate cognitive resources hierarchically when reading. This model, based on the principle of hierarchical resource rationality, explains why certain words require more effort to process. The model's development was driven by a desire to understand and replicate human reading behaviors. The model's findings were published in Nature.
Bioengineer.org and Tech Xplore both noted that the model's insights could lead to personalized text and improved augmented reality experiences. Euronews.com explored the broader implications of AI in understanding human cognition. Neuroscience News focused on the differences between human reading patterns and AI processing, as revealed by eye-tracking studies. The model's ability to fully replicate human reading behavior is not yet established.
The specific applications of this model in educational settings or assistive technologies are not yet clear. The extent to which this model can be applied to languages other than English is also unknown.
